A caring and compassionate grief book for bereaved parents who have lost a child
Being suddenly thrust into the world of parental grief is like being transported to a foreign land where you dont speak the language With that in mind Claire Aagaard has written When a Child Dies in a simple straightforward manner offering information comfort and hope for those who believe that none is possible
Questions addressed include Can we survive this Is it possible to be happy again Is forgiveness attainable Can we survive this as a couple How will this affect our loved ones Is it okay to be angry with God How do we cope with birthdays or holidays Will my grief ever change What can we do to help a chapter for supportive loved ones
Claire has written this book from a unique perspectivethat of a professional grief counselor after working with dozens of bereaved parents and as a parent with her own history of child loss It is an honest yet gentle guide for grieving parents as well as their family friends and loved ones offering the wisdom from her own personal journey as well as that of countless others
